| dc.description | UNAM’s Khomasdal Campus concluded the MUPIT exchange programme with Inland Norway University of Applied Sciences, culminating in a joint symposium at the SANORD 2024 Conference in Cape Town. Student-teachers Meloline Herunga and Matias Ntinda presented insights on pedagogy and multicultural classroom experiences, alongside their Norwegian colleague Solveig Brusdal Hamstad. UNAM lecturers and leaders highlighted the programme’s impact on research capacity, global perspectives, and inclusive teaching. The initiative reinforces UNAM’s commitment to equitable and culturally responsive education through South–North partnerships. | en_US |
